Output 6328c8cba106ab1b260f232f539530cc78d99a7da0646f7384721e0fb1a6b8cc:0

value
2312652
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 954bdfa43fa4395e866611a80186c0426bee54b5 OP_EQUALVERIFY OP_CHECKSIG
address
1EcQaNdNPnAu6xBZmePs3YqG3siKMV5SWn
transaction
6328c8cba106ab1b260f232f539530cc78d99a7da0646f7384721e0fb1a6b8cc
spent
true